The Friend Magazine

Our church has a magazine subscription you can have mailed to you or you can download to your device. This is the kids version (intended for age 3-11) we have another for the youth and then adults. 


We love having this in our home as another way to bring the spirit into our home. There are so many great features in the magazine that can be used in conjunction to teaching the children. One of the greatest features they added this years monthly editions is the COME FOLLOW ME marker on the pages that tie to that months weekly personal studies and lessons. 


Sometimes having these little helps make teaching kids a lot easier for busy parents. We love having these extra stories, games and coloring pages for our boys as we go through the lessons as a family to prepare for that weeks Sunday meetings. 





Another fun page they have is a page filled with content from kids by kids. Kids can write letters in, share pictures and stories they then have a chance to have them published. 


Another cool thing about The Friend is that it is like having 2 magazines in 1. From one side it is geared towards SR Primary (age 8-10) and from the other side it is geared towards Jr Primary (ages 3-8). The content is then geared toward those ages 


One of our favorite pages is the easy reader/ Picto reading. my boys love reading and this gives them the chance to read by themselves.


The stories are shorter in the JR side and have more pictures. This section also has the COME FOLLOW ME markers on the page for teaching the younger group. Our 4 year old loves when we use this for family study to talk about the weeks lessons.
